Event-related potentials in the elderly with new mild hypertension

Summary
Mild hypertension in the elderly is linked to early cognitive changes. Specifically, prolonged N2 latency, a measure of brain function, correlates with higher systolic blood pressure, suggesting potential therapeutic targets.

Background:
- Hypertension is a significant risk factor for cerebrovascular diseases and cognitive impairment, particularly in the elderly.
- The risk of cerebrovascular disease increases with blood pressure levels in older adults.
Purpose of the Study:
- To investigate early cognitive functional alterations in elderly individuals with newly diagnosed mild hypertension.
- To assess the relationship between blood pressure, cognitive function, and neurophysiological markers in this population.
Main Methods:
- 24-hour ambulatory blood pressure monitoring (ABPM) was performed on 20 elderly hypertensive patients and 10 elderly normotensive controls.
- Cognitive state was evaluated using the Mini-Mental-State-Examination (MMSE).
- Acoustic evoked potentials, specifically P300 and N2 latencies, were recorded.
Main Results:
- No significant difference in P300 latency was observed between hypertensive and normotensive elderly groups.
- Elderly hypertensive patients exhibited a statistically significant prolonged N2 latency compared to normotensive controls.
- A significant correlation was found between N2 latency and systolic blood pressure values in hypertensive individuals.
Conclusions:
- Early functional alterations in cognitive state are present in elderly individuals with mild hypertension.
- These cognitive changes are associated with systolic blood pressure levels.
- Findings suggest the potential for earlier therapeutic interventions in elderly hypertensive patients.
